作 者:罗顺刚 康宁 胡红英 LUO Shun-gang;KANG Ning;HU Hong-ying(Key Laboratory of Biological Resources Genetic Engineering/College of Life Science and Technology,Xinjiang University,Urumqi 830046,China)
机构地区:[1]新疆大学生命科学与技术学院/新疆生物资源基因工程重点实验室,乌鲁木齐830046
出 处:《西南农业学报》2022年第12期2906-2911,共6页Southwest China Journal of Agricultural Sciences
基 金:国家自然科学基金项目(31860612)。
摘 要:【目的】记述中国新纪录属黄伊克跳小蜂属(Xanthoectroma)中的一新纪录种——西班牙黄伊克跳小蜂(Xanthoectroma aquilinum Mercet, 1925),提供该种的DNA条形码信息,既为开展该新纪录种的生物学、生态学、分子生物学研究提供参考,同时丰富跳小蜂科的物种信息。【方法】对网扫标本进行挑拣,并在数码体视显微镜下进行形态特征观察和数据测量;利用无损伤提取法提取基因组DNA,用通用引物扩增西班牙黄伊克跳小蜂(X.aquilinum)的线粒体基因(Cytochrome Oxidase I, COI),将其序列作为该种的DNA条形码。【结果】该新纪录种雌性主要特征为整体呈黄色,具明显的盾纵沟;翅端部略超过腹部的1/2,后缘脉与缘脉等长,腹部明显长于头胸之和。雄性主要特征为体长明显短于雌性,头顶部为棕色,胸部背面为深棕色,腹部末端具明显的三角状黑棕色斑点。提供了该新纪录种的彩色整体图和局部鉴定特征图以及COI基因序列,通过构建系统发育树发现其与长索跳小蜂属(Anagyrus)的和班氏跳小蜂属(Aenasius)亲缘关系最近。【结论】本次发现的中国新纪录种为西班牙黄伊克跳小蜂(X.aquilinum Mercet, 1925),并上传其COI基因序列至NCBI。【Objective】A new record species of the genus Xanthoectroma from China—Xanthoectroma aquilinum Mercet 1925 is described detailly, and the DNA bar code information of this species is also provided, which is a reference for the study of biology, ecology and molecular biology of this new record species, and also to enrich the data of the Encyrtidae.【Method】 The net-sweeped specimens were sorted, the morphological characteristics were observed and measured under a digital stereo microscope;Genomic DNA was extracted using non-damage extraction method, and the mitochondria Cytochrome Oxidase I(COI) gene of X.aquilinum was amplified with universal primers. 【Result】The main identification characteristics of female specimens were whole body yellow and with obvious sulcus;The tip of the wing was slightly more than 1/2 of the abdomen, the postmarginal vein was the same length as the marginal vein, and the abdomen was significantly longer than the sum of the head and thorax. The main identification characteristics of male specimens were that the body length was significantly shorter than that of females, the top of the head was brown, the back of the thorax was dark brown, and the end of the abdomen has obvious triangular black-brown spots. The identification characteristic figures of the new record species, as well as the COI genetic sequence, were provided, the phylogenetic tree showed that it was more closely related to Anagyrus and Aenasius.【Conclusion】The new record species is X.aquilinum Mercet 1925,upload the COI gene sequence to NCBI.
